Geekbench 2.1
Geekbench is a cross-platform benchmark for Mac OS X, Windows, and
Linux.
Geekbench tries to measure the performance an average application can
expect from the computer being benchmarked. As such, all of the
benchmarks in Geekbench are written in platform-neutral C and C++, and
have no platform-specific optimizations, and Geekbench is compiled with
what we consider the de-facto standard compiler for each platform, with
the compiler switches suggested by the compiler for release code.
